Você está perdendo oportunidades de negociação:
- Aplicativos de negociação gratuitos
- 8 000+ sinais para cópia
- Notícias econômicas para análise dos mercados financeiros
Registro
Login
Você concorda com a política do site e com os termos de uso
Se você não tem uma conta, por favor registre-se
Agora estamos em fevereiro de 2023 - mais de dois meses de novo histórico com relação aos testes nas imagens da balança. Você pode mostrar os resultados dos EAs com as mesmas configurações nos novos dados? Ou os anteriores que não estavam envolvidos na otimização.
Agora estamos em fevereiro de 2023 - mais de dois meses de novo histórico com relação aos testes nas imagens da balança. Você pode mostrar os resultados dos EAs com as mesmas configurações nos novos dados? Bem, ou os anteriores que não estavam envolvidos na otimização.
Agora estamos em fevereiro de 2023 - mais de dois meses de novo histórico com relação aos testes nas imagens da balança. Você pode mostrar os resultados dos EAs com as mesmas configurações nos novos dados? Ou os anteriores que não estavam envolvidos na otimização.
Não posso agora. Faça a otimização você mesmo.
TP =60
Sim, eu já vi isso. Mas, ainda assim, achei interessante a visão do autor sobre os preditores....
Não posso fazer isso no momento. Faça a otimização você mesmo.
Bem, talvez mais tarde, em uma semana ou um mês?
Bem, talvez mais tarde - daqui a uma semana ou um mês?
Talvez
Mas se você treinar em 2020 e testar em 2021, elas perdem exatamente o oposto.
Além disso, enquanto eu estudava o que são redes neurais, entendi para que serve a função de ativação - para a propagação para trás do erro, que é o treinamento. Ou seja, o ajuste dos pesos durante a otimização acaba com o significado das funções de ativação e, consequentemente, das redes neurais clássicas. O resultado é quase o mesmo com a função de ativação e com o mais simples perceptron de Reshetov.
E digo mais: os perceptrons mais simples mostram ainda melhor a imagem, e todos os tipos de desordem na forma de bibliotecas simplesmente sobrecarregam o terminal.
Portanto, é melhor verificar vários anos seguidos e vários pares de moedas. Sim, é trabalhoso, mas o resultado será mais objetivo.
Todos os itens acima são imho. Agradeço ao autor pelo artigo, a parte sobre o perceptron é interessante, vou me aprofundar no assunto
Uau! Romano,
Este artigo cobre exatamente o que estou tentando realizar!
Usando um DNN de 3 ou 4 camadas, executei os testes por um dia e exportei os resultados para o Excel por meio do processo XML na guia Otimização para criar uma planilha do Excel que salvei como um arquivo CSV. Usando o arquivo CSV, estou planejando importá-lo para o EA e, em seguida, executar uma otimização para selecionar a melhor estratégia entre os 1.000 resultados otimizados mais altos em um teste de dados avançados.Algumas coisas que aprendi: primeiro, salve as entradas do EA em um arquivo .SET em mql5\profiles\tester e você poderá editar o arquivo .SET no NotePad, o que é muito mais fácil do que usar a guia de entrada para modificar grupos de entrada. A segunda coisa é que os testes que fiz tiveram um número muito pequeno de negociações. A última é tomar cuidado com as vírgulas no arquivo CSV, especialmente se você tiver valores acima de US$ 1.000,00. As colunas de patrimônio líquido e lucro têm uma vírgula definida para 1.000 valores, portanto, quando os dados são salvos em um arquivo CSV, vírgulas adicionais são incluídas. Se você estiver usando o StringSplit, como eu, para identificar o início e depois analisar os neurônios otimizados na matriz Weight, as duas vírgulas adicionais deverão ser incluídas nos cálculos.
Estou anexando um arquivo PNG do gráfico de dispersão de equidade para uma execução de otimização concluída para um DNN 433 de 2 anos usando EURUSD H4 na função Original. Como você pode ver, há uma preponderância de resultados na linha 2900 ou acima dela, e o número acima aumenta drasticamente à medida que o número de otimizações se aproxima do final da execução, o que é esperado. Meu plano é escolher os 1000 melhores e, em seguida, usar os dados avançados para identificar os melhores pesos otimizados correspondentes da otimização anterior.Como as otimizações genéticas aumentam exponencialmente com base no número de camadas e no número de neurônios, uma otimização completa do GA para um grande número de neurônios e estratégias de negociação complexas e cálculos de stop loss será impossível para a maioria das máquinas. No entanto, identificar a linha de base, por exemplo 2900 e também obter alguns milhares de resultados para usar deve resultar substancialmente em tempos de execução do GA mais razoáveis e também deve resultar em opções boas, mas não as melhores, para o EA para testes futuros em dados ativos. Descobri que você pode exportar as otimizações para o Excel enquanto os agentes do GA continuam a ser executados, portanto, você pode determinar quando tem 100 otimizações acima da linha de base usando a função CONT.SE do Excel.
Estou anexando um arquivo PNG do gráfico de dispersão de equidade para uma execução de otimização concluída para um DNN 433 de 2 anos usando EURUSD H4 na função Original. Como você pode ver, há uma preponderância de resultados na linha 2900 ou acima dela, e o número acima aumenta drasticamente à medida que o número de otimizações se aproxima do final da execução, o que é esperado. Meu plano é escolher os 1000 melhores e, em seguida, usar os dados avançados para identificar os melhores pesos otimizados correspondentes da otimização anterior.Como as otimizações genéticas aumentam exponencialmente com base no número de camadas e no número de neurônios, uma otimização completa do GA para um grande número de neurônios e estratégias de negociação complexas e cálculos de stop loss será impossível para a maioria das máquinas. No entanto, identificar a linha de base, por exemplo 2900 e também obter alguns milhares de resultados para usar deve resultar substancialmente em tempos de execução do GA mais razoáveis e também deve resultar em opções boas, mas não as melhores, para o EA para testes futuros em dados ativos. Descobri que você pode exportar as otimizações para o Excel enquanto os agentes do GA continuam a ser executados, portanto, você pode determinar quando tem 100 otimizações acima da linha de base usando a função CONT.SE do Excel.
Obrigado por seu interesse em minhas publicações. Acho que suas ideias podem ser implementadas. Mas, como você pode ver, tudo depende da parte de ferro da nossa pergunta - os computadores.
Esse trabalho é incrível, obrigado, Roman!
Estou enfrentando um problema em que não consigo compilar nenhum dos MQ5s do Perceptron "1 perceptron 4 angle SL TP - trade", por exemplo, tem 22 erros, a maioria deles sendo um ponto e vírgula esperado. Estou perdendo alguma coisa ou fiz algo errado?